Think of Prince Edward County and rolling pastures, lush meadows, and picture-perfect natural beauty quickly comes to mind. Think of a home there, and the historic one located at 1164 Danforth Road is the ideal fit.
The three-bedroom, four-bathroom home in the small community of Hillier lends itself flawlessly to the locale. From the outset, you’re greeted with a board-and batten-siding that offers a graceful introduction, set behind a stacked stone fence. A tidy porch brings you to the front door.
Inside, the interior is bright, spacious, and open. It has picture windows that help to seam the indoors and out. As far as a Prince Edward County farmhouse goes, this one chooses to blend modern comfort with historic charm.

Take the kitchen, for example. Described in the listing as the home’s “centrepiece” — it’s crafted by Muti with Italian cabinetry, Verona quartz counters, and Thermador appliances, including a six-burner range with grill. The dark blue island and cabinetry stand out as a highlight, almost like a pond offering reprieve in the middle of the house.
With thoughtful features that include a windowed dining area, blackout blinds and custom closets throughout, as well as an infrared sauna and high-efficiency geothermal heating and cooling, this country home truly has it all.
Meanwhile, the bedrooms are spacious and airy while continuing to hold the rustic character that runs throughout the rest of the home, complete with exposed wood ceiling beams overhead.

Venturing outdoors, you’ll find the hand-built dry-stone wall: “a piece of living artistry that grounds the home in its pastoral setting,” according to the listing.
Adding to the property’s appeal: A large workshop that offers its new owner the choice to outfit it as a creative studio, office space, or both.
Even more compellingly, this is a home that tells a story. The property dates back to the 1850s, which is evidenced by its exposed beams, hand-planed boards and original chimney cupboards and flooring.
Beyond the property, Hillier has earned its place as a charming community within Prince Edward County, one of Ontario's most popular destinations known for its vineyards and wineries, beaches and parks, arts and culture, and its thriving farm-to-table food scene.
